在做花卉数据增量的时候,对102flowers进行数据增量处理,在百度上直接截取图片的话,效率太低,在这里使用python网络爬虫,仅需要输入特定的图片名称,便可以直接获取大量相关图片,本例以获取rose为例进行爬取。参考之前博主的代码,稍微进行修改即可。
直接代码
import requests
import os
def getManyPages(keyword,pages):
params=[]
for i in range(30,30*pages+30,30):
params.append({
'tn': 'resultjson_com',
'ipn': 'rj',
'ct': 201326592,
'is': '',
'fp': 'result',
'queryWord': keyword,
'cl': 2,
'lm': -1,
'ie': 'utf-8',
'oe': 'utf-8',
'adpicid': '',
'st': -1,